    HP Spectre x360 13-4109na Intel Core i7-6500U HD520 Graphics NEW BRICK


    Hi Chaps,

    BRANDNEW. ARRIVED 6 DAYS AGO
    HP Spectre x360 13-4109na -(Intel Core i7-6500U, Windows 10, 8GB DDR3L, 512GB SDRAM, Intel HD Graphics520)
    Supplied with Windows 10home and updated to Windows 10 home with m/s update 1511
    Video Scheduler driver STOPPED RESPONDING/ VIDEO SCHEDULER INTERNAL ERROR andsimilar Errors ABOUT FOUR TIMES DAILY. Usually whilst using IE/FIREFOX usuallywhen changing page/scrolling. COULD IT BE RELATED TO POPUPS OR OTHER VIDEO ON SCREEN?
    Event viewer shows: Display driver igfx stoppedresponding and has successfully recovered. Event ID 4101
    Think this is 0x119 error.

    Sometimes blue screens but more often recovers,

    Rolled driver back to
    10 18 15 4256 No improvement.

    There appear to be some beta drivers available here: https://downloadcenter.intel.com/dow...7-8-1-10-15-40 - but I cannot get the Win 10 64 bit version to install.

    "The driver being installed is not validated for this computer" error arises.
    there are some instructions to bypass this here: https://steamcommunity.com/app/23325...9190911446231/
    I do only have one graphics card. Is this the way forward?

    OK folks followed the instructions carefully, essentially telling the P.C. to search yourself, have driver and have disc then navigate to folder you have saved and extracted to. Note also, it is best to download the zipped file since it contains graphics, display/audio and language items and so you can choose graphics separately. I could not get the single 154012 exe file to load the graphics driver. Now running beta driver 20.19.15.4326 dated 18.11.15. Time will tell

    As the 0x119 is GPU related, please stress test the GPU and clean install the drivers.
    Please uninstall everything of Intel graphics using Display Driver Uninstaller and install new drivers from Intel. Be sure to ONLY install the drivers using custom/advanced options.



    Diagnostic test

     GPU TEST


    Run Furmark to test your GPU. Furmark tutorial

    Note   Note
    Run Furmark for around 30 minutes


    warning   Warning
    Your GPU temperatures will rise quickly while Furmark is running. Keep a keen eye on them and abort the test if temperatures rise too high
